gpt4 book ai didi

jquery - 使用 jquery 创建幻灯片放映

转载 作者:行者123 更新时间:2023-11-28 04:21:40 27 4
gpt4 key购买 nike

我想使用 jQuery 制作一个简单的幻灯片,但是当我使用这段代码时,第二行出现错误。

这里是错误:缺少“使用严格”语句

$(function(){
$('.slider img:gt(0)').hide();
setInterval(function(){
$('.slider:first-child').fadeOut(1000).next('img').fadeIn(1000).end().appendTo('.slider');},4000);
});
.slider{
float:right;
width:100%;
height:245px;
background:#E8E4E4;
border:1px solid #7894A6;
}
.slider img{
float:right;
width:100%;
height:245px;
background:#E8E4E4;
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<div class="slider">
<img src="images/1.jpg"/>
<img src="images/2.jpg"/>
<img src="images/3.jpg"/>
</div>

最佳答案

这很可能是 linter 警告,而不是错误。您的代码可能不会因为缺少“使用严格”而中断但是,要删除该警告,您需要在 javascript 的第一行或函数声明内部包含“use strict”。另外,我冒昧地对您的代码进行了格式化,使其更易于阅读/理解:

$(function(){
"use strict"
$('.slider img:gt(0)').hide();
setInterval(function(){
$('.slider:first-child')
.fadeOut(1000)
.next('img')
.fadeIn(1000)
.end()
.appendTo('.slider');
}, 4000);
});

http://www.w3schools.com/js/js_strict.asp

关于jquery - 使用 jquery 创建幻灯片放映,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/42178034/

27 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com